Marriage Scheme Assistance

A sum of Rs.20,000/-  is given as Marriage Scheme Assistance to both male, female employees and their wards.

Eligibility

  • The maximum age limit of an employee to avail the scheme benefits is upto 60 years of age.
  • Employee should have contributed to Labour Welfare Fund for the previous year to avail the scheme benefits for the current year.
  • The maximum salary of the employees to avail the scheme benefits is Rs.35,000/- (Basic pay + DA).
  • The last date for receipt of application in Board is three months from the Date of Marriage. 
  • Employees / Their wards(Female) who availed this Marriage assistance from Social Welfare Department are not eligible to avail this scheme benefit from the Board.
  • In case more than one person is an employee, such as mother / father / bride / bride groom, only one person should apply for Marriage Assistance.
  • If more than one application is received, the application received first alone will be taken for consideration.
  • This sheme benefit can be availed only, if the Marraige is registered.


Certificates to be enclosed

  • Attested copy of Marriage registration certificate.
  • Original marriage invitation.
  • Attested copy of Aadhar card and ration card for all (Employee / Bride / Bride groom).
  • Copy of LWF payment receipt.
  • Salary slip for the month in which LWF deducted from the employee.
  • Previous month salary slip of the Employee.
  • Copy of bank passbook front page of the employee - 2 copies.
